Katherine Morton, Manager, Planning Strategies and Eniber Cabrera, Development Planner provided an overview of the Off-street Parking Regulations Update and Report on Engagement.
Committee Members engaged in discussion and enquired about precinct justifications, parking evaluations, and noted concerns with the reduction of parking and relying on on-street parking. Ms. Morton and Ms. Cabrera responded to questions and Andrew Whittemore, Commissioner, Planning and Building advised that planning staff would follow-up with the committee members concerns and report back in the first quarter of 2022.

The following persons spoke:
- Patrick Lazzara, Resident noted concerns with the reduction of parking and requested that staff review updated parking regulations based on the Covid 19 pandemic.
- Brennan Bempong, Resident noted concerns with the reduction of parking and requested that staff review alternatives for public parking such as partnerships with the school boards and parking at community centres.
- Jonathan Giggs, Resident noted concerns with parking minimums and enquired about how many parking spaces exist in Mississauga.
Ms. Morton and Mr. Whittemore responded to questions.
